<P>PROBLEM TO BE SOLVED: To provide an optical disk substrate which has excellent strength, moldability, mold parting properties, transferability, and birefringence and is inexpensive. <P>SOLUTION: The optical disk substrate consists of a rubber denatured styrene resin composition (GS resin composition) essentially consisting of a styrene-(meth)acrylate copolymer composed of a styrene monomer (S), (meth) acrylate monomer (M) and vinyl monomer (V) copolymerizable with these monomers and graft copolymer formed by copolymerizing (S), (M) and (V) copolymerizable with these monomers in the presence of a diene rubber elastic body, in which the weight average molecular weight (Mw) of the TFH-soluble component of the GS resin composition is 50,000 to 100,000; the amount of the diene rubber in the GS resin composition is 5 to 15%; the (S) unit is 5 to 35%; the (M) unit it 50 to 90%; the (V) unit copolymerizable therewith is 0 to 10% and the rubber grain size of the GS resin composition is 0.1 to 0.5 μm. <P>COPYRIGHT: (C)2003,JPO |
